Russian Qt Forum
Апрель 26, 2024, 20:39 *
Добро пожаловать, Гость. Пожалуйста, войдите или зарегистрируйтесь.
Вам не пришло письмо с кодом активации?

Войти
 
  Начало   Форум  WIKI (Вики)FAQ Помощь Поиск Войти Регистрация  

Страниц: 1 [2]   Вниз
  Печать  
Автор Тема: Оптимизация плагинов  (Прочитано 7733 раз)
Igors
Джедай : наставник для всех
*******
Offline Offline

Сообщений: 11445


Просмотр профиля
« Ответ #15 : Октябрь 24, 2016, 08:45 »

Выделил. Может объективно это ничего не дает, но я много полазил по чужому коду и теперь знаю его лучше  Улыбающийся

Реализована типичная схема "lazy" (как напр в QLayout). Т.е. очень многие могут установить флажок "dirty". Сами расчеты выполняются по запросу и только если dirty = true, после пересчета dirty сбрасывается в false. Если время изменилось то данные загружаются с линейки времени и тоже взводится dirty. Хмм.. пока не соображу что надо делать.
Записан
Страниц: 1 [2]   Вверх
  Печать  
 
Перейти в:  


Страница сгенерирована за 0.043 секунд. Запросов: 22.